Wat is String naar Hex?
String naar Hex is een conversieproces waarbij een tekststring (bestaande uit leesbare tekens) wordt omgezet naar de hexadecimale (basis 16) weergave. In deze indeling wordt elk teken weergegeven door een tweecijferige hexadecimale waarde op basis van de ASCII- (of Unicode-)code. De string "Hi" wordt bijvoorbeeld "48 69" in hexadecimaal, waarbij H = 48 en i = 69 (in hexadecimaal).
Waarom String naar Hex gebruiken?
Datacodering: Hex is een compacte manier om binaire of tekstgegevens weer te geven, vaak gebruikt in netwerken, geheugendumps en low-level programmeren.
Beveiliging en encryptie: Sommige encryptiemethoden of hash-algoritmen gebruiken of produceren hex-uitvoer. String naar Hex kan helpen bij het testen of debuggen van deze systemen.
Webontwikkeling: URL's, cookies en andere componenten moeten soms gegevens in hex coderen vanwege compatibiliteit en beveiliging.
Compatibiliteit tussen systemen: Hex is handig voor het overbrengen van gegevens tussen systemen of applicaties die niet-standaard coderingsformaten vereisen.
Hoe gebruik je String naar Hex?
Open een tool: Gebruik een online converter, een code-editorextensie of schrijf een eenvoudig script in een programmeertaal zoals Python, JavaScript of PHP.
Voer je string in: Voer de tekst in die je wilt converteren. Bijvoorbeeld "Hallo" of "1234".
De hexadecimale uitvoer ophalen: De tool converteert elk teken naar de bijbehorende tweecijferige hexadecimale code en geeft de volledige hexadecimale tekenreeks weer.
Het resultaat gebruiken of kopiëren: Gebruik het resultaat in uw applicatie, datastream of waar het hexadecimale formaat vereist is.
Wanneer String naar Hex gebruiken?
Binaire gegevens debuggen: Bij het inspecteren van byte-level representaties van strings of het analyseren van geheugen-/databuffers.
Codering in API's of URL's: Wanneer strings in hex moeten worden gecodeerd voor Veilige transmissie of naleving.
Beveiligingstoepassingen: Voor het vergelijken, analyseren of opslaan van hashes, encryptiesleutels of gecodeerde content.
Embedded systemen en netwerken: Bij het ontwikkelen van software voor hardware of netwerkprotocollen die hex-gebaseerde communicatie vereisen.